Foros del Web » Programación para mayores de 30 ;) » Bases de Datos General »

una consulta para comparar tablas!!

Estas en el tema de una consulta para comparar tablas!! en el foro de Bases de Datos General en Foros del Web. Que tal, quiza esta consulta es algo tonta, pero para un principiante no lo es. Lo que pasa es que tengo dos tablas Hoja1 y ...
  #1 (permalink)  
Antiguo 22/02/2008, 12:58
 
Fecha de Ingreso: febrero-2008
Mensajes: 12
Antigüedad: 16 años, 9 meses
Puntos: 0
una consulta para comparar tablas!!

Que tal, quiza esta consulta es algo tonta, pero para un principiante no lo es. Lo que pasa es que tengo dos tablas Hoja1 y Hoja2. Los campos de Hoja1 son:(CCT,SUBSISTEMA, ESCUELA,DOMICILIO) y para Hoja2 son (REGION, MUNICIPIO, SUBNIVEL, ESCUELA, CLAVE, DOMICILIO). El caso es que son escuelas almacenadas en dos tablas, pero hay escuelas que no estan en una tabla y si en la otra. Al final quiero hacer una sola tabla con todas las escuelas. No se que instruccion de SQL ocupar. El campo que contiene datos similares o el que servira para la relacion es el CCT de una tabla y CLAVE de la otra, pues son las claves de las escuelas. Gracias, estoy trabajando en acces, pero despues lo hare en otro manejador mas potente. Espero su ayuda.

Última edición por metroyd; 22/02/2008 a las 13:10
  #2 (permalink)  
Antiguo 04/03/2008, 10:17
 
Fecha de Ingreso: julio-2007
Ubicación: Durango, Mex.
Mensajes: 45
Antigüedad: 17 años, 4 meses
Puntos: 0
Re: una consulta para comparar tablas!!

Hola, en la consulta quieres que aparezcan todas las escuelas o solo aquellas que esten en ambas tablas?

Puedes usar una instruccion sql que haga referencia a las 2 tablas pero debes tener un campo por el que se relacionen suponiendo que CCT y CLAVE son para el mismo dato, seria algo como:

SELECT CCT,SUBSISTEMA, ESCUELA, DOMICILIO,REGION,MUNICIPIO,SUBNIVEL WHERE Hoja1.CC T= Hoja2.CLAVE

con esto mostraria los registros que coincidan en ambas tablas.
  #3 (permalink)  
Antiguo 04/03/2008, 14:43
 
Fecha de Ingreso: febrero-2008
Mensajes: 12
Antigüedad: 16 años, 9 meses
Puntos: 0
Re: una consulta para comparar tablas!!

Cita:
Iniciado por dabiaco Ver Mensaje
Hola, en la consulta quieres que aparezcan todas las escuelas o solo aquellas que esten en ambas tablas?

Puedes usar una instruccion sql que haga referencia a las 2 tablas pero debes tener un campo por el que se relacionen suponiendo que CCT y CLAVE son para el mismo dato, seria algo como:

SELECT CCT,SUBSISTEMA, ESCUELA, DOMICILIO,REGION,MUNICIPIO,SUBNIVEL WHERE Hoja1.CC T= Hoja2.CLAVE

con esto mostraria los registros que coincidan en ambas tablas.

Orale gracias, me ha funcionado. Gracias!!
  #4 (permalink)  
Antiguo 04/03/2008, 18:34
 
Fecha de Ingreso: julio-2007
Ubicación: Durango, Mex.
Mensajes: 45
Antigüedad: 17 años, 4 meses
Puntos: 0
De acuerdo Re: una consulta para comparar tablas!!

Por nada, que bueno que te sirvio
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 22:57.